Output 3b63d63899a54dc721e775dd66a56ecef0c6abecad790b95541c1596f2014581:14

value
1593424
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3457808f5a0d0da5d8725dc5a4229326a7a8a41 OP_EQUALVERIFY OP_CHECKSIG
address
1JoVzC1VCRuGUNv6zpQb8VgeSMXUH1WtpZ
transaction
3b63d63899a54dc721e775dd66a56ecef0c6abecad790b95541c1596f2014581
spent
true